Pier Insurance Lite Terms & Conditions
Definitions
1. “Equipment” shall mean the Mobile Phone and its battery and mains
charger as specified on the policy schedule including any
replacement Equipment provided by or loaned by Us
2. “Unattended” shall mean not within Your sight at all times and/or out
of Your arms-length reach
3. “We/Us/Our” shall mean Pier Insurance Managed Services Limited
4. “You/Your” shall mean the private individual or company detailed on
the policy schedule
The Cover
UK General Insurance on behalf of Ageas Insurance Limited Registered in
England No.354568. Registered Office Ageas House Tollgate Eastleigh
Hampshire SO53 3YA (the insurer) will subject to the exclusions and
conditions indemnify You by payment or at its option by replacement (with
identical Equipment or Equipment of comparable specification up to a
maximum retail value of €375) or repair in respect of accidental damage
liquid damage or theft of the Equipment occurring during the Period of
Insurance
Exclusions
The Insurer shall not be liable for
1. theft of the Equipment from any unattended vehicle unless all
windows are closed all doors are securely locked all security devices
are activated and the Equipment is concealed from view in a locked
glove compartment locked boot or locked load area
2. theft of the Equipment from any premises or mode of transport unless
involving forcible and violent entry or exit
3. theft of the Equipment from the person of the user unless involving
force or the threat thereof
4. theft of the Equipment whilst left Unattended when it is away from
your home
5. repair or replacement arising as a result of negligent use wilful abuse
or misuse
6. damage to the battery or aerial or any cosmetic damage
7. the cost of replacing or repairing accessories or costs arising from the
use of accessories
8. the cost of routine inspection service adjustment or cleaning
9. any amount recoverable under any guarantee warranty or other
insurance
10. loss of the Equipment loss of use or any other costs that are directly
or indirectly caused by the event which led to your claim unless
specifically stated in this policy
11. repairs carried out by persons not authorised by Us
12. the policy excess as detailed below
13. the cost of replacing any stored data including but not limited to tunes
songs personalised ring tones pictures films or graphics
14. any damage or fault caused by any form of electronic virus
